public void TypeExtensions()
 {
     foreach (var name in OperationInfo.GetOperationNames(typeof(IWorkflowActivity<ITestGrainAffector, ITestGrainEffector>).GetGenericArguments()[0]))
         Console.WriteLine(name);
     foreach (var name in OperationInfo.GetOperationNames(typeof(IWorkflowActivity<ITestGrainAffector, ITestGrainEffector>).GetGenericArguments()[1]))
         Console.WriteLine(name);
 }
示例#2
0
 public void TypeExtensions()
 {
     foreach (var name in OperationInfo.GetOperationNames(typeof(IWorkflowActivity <ITestWorkflowInterface, ITestWorkflowCallbackInterface>).GetGenericArguments()[0]))
     {
         Console.WriteLine(name);
     }
     foreach (var name in OperationInfo.GetOperationNames(typeof(IWorkflowActivity <ITestWorkflowInterface, ITestWorkflowCallbackInterface>).GetGenericArguments()[1]))
     {
         Console.WriteLine(name);
     }
 }